Precious Metal Exchange Rates in the USA

Live bullion exchange rates in the USA fluctuate rapidly based on worldwide market trends. Buyers can view these figures through various online platforms and financial websites. The cost of gold is typically quoted in US dollars per troy ounce, with movements occurring throughout the trading day.

  • Factors that affect gold prices include:
  • Political instability
  • Interest rates
  • Investor confidence
